[問題] Integer[] 轉成 int[]
如果現在手邊有一個 Integer[] 的陣列
想要把它轉為 int[]
Integer[] origin;
int[] result = new int[origin.length];
for(int i=0; i<result.length; i++){
result[i] = origin[i];
}
上面這個最傳統的方法也還需要線性時間
請問還有比線性時間更快的方法嗎?
( 其實是想問java還有沒有其他好用的 function 可用~ :p)
謝謝
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.112.107.147
推
05/11 16:54, , 1F
05/11 16:54, 1F
→
05/11 16:56, , 2F
05/11 16:56, 2F
推
05/11 17:25, , 3F
05/11 17:25, 3F
討論串 (同標題文章)
以下文章回應了本文 (最舊先):
完整討論串 (本文為第 1 之 3 篇):